Explore Georgia: Tybee Island Tips No One Tells You About

Ever wonder how can you maximize your visit to Tybee Island? We have gathered the best insider tips so you can plan a dream trip to one of the most unique places you'll ever visit. BEST PLACE TO LAY DOWN YOUR TOWEL Park near the Tybee Beach Beach and Pavilion ( Tybrisa St, Tybee Island, GA 31328) use the bridge  in front of the Tybee Island Marine Center  turn right and walk towards the rock formation close to the sand dunes. This portion of the beach has a smoother sand, lots of shallow areas that are perfect for little kids to bathe safely, is less crowded, and because it's close to the sand dunes you will see a large variety of seaside birds.

The World's Most Comfortable Ergonomic Pen If you suffer from hand cramps or pain while you are writing (also known as Dystonia) I have good news ya!   For some people, writing is something that cause pain as soon as they pick up a pen--or within writing a few words, and impedes them to write with normal speed and accuracy. In dystonic writer's cramp, symptoms will be present not only when the person is writing, but also when performing other activities, such as shaving, using eating utensils, applying make-up. Common symptoms include, for example, excessive gripping of a pen or utensil, flexing of the wrist, elevation of the elbow, and occasional extension of a finger or fingers causing the utensil to fall from the hand. Halloween Events We Love! Day of the Dead, Dia de los Muertos at Atlanta History Center October 27

 "Legend says that the gates of heaven open at midnight, and that the souls of dead children –  angelitos  – are the first to visit their loved ones still on earth. They roam the earth for just one day, and then the following midnight, the gates are opened once again to allow the adult souls to descend". Enjoy a day of cultural exploration during the Atlanta History Center’s annual family program, Day of the Dead or Dia de Muertos. Visitors of all ages enjoy learning about this ancient festival rooted in Mexican heritage and that serves as a way for families to remember their deceased loved ones while celebrating their children and the continuity of life. Smiling faces, swirling brilliant colors, storytelling, elaborately decorated altars designed to honor lost family and friends, authentic Mexican food, music, and variety of performances are highlights of this celebration. Currently Obsessed With: Abigail Brown Beautiful Hand-Stitched Birds

Spruce up your home decor with these one-of-a-kind hand-stitched birds from Abigail Brown. Abigail produces her birds entirely by hand, in her studio in London, England. They are crafted from both new and reused materials. Each piece is utterly unique, no two pieces will ever be the same. You can find her birds available for sale in the shop. She has enjoyed coverage in magazines such as Vogue, Harper's Bazaar, Elle Decoration and Selvedge, been included in books published in Germany, USA, UK, Japan, South Korea and Taiwan, and has sold her work through many beautiful stores including Liberty in London, Takashimaya in New York, Bensimon in Paris, Paul Smith in both London in Paris and through smaller but equally exquisite boutiques the world over.   Her work centres around animals because they fascinate and inspire her.
